| Estimate item | Why it matters | Question to ask |
|---|---|---|
| Exterior conditions | Moisture, mulch, vegetation, gaps, and entry points affect whether treatment holds. | Which exterior conditions should the homeowner correct before or after service? |
| Follow-up policy | A cheap first visit can be poor value if retreatment or monitoring is excluded. | How many visits are included, and what triggers a no-charge callback? |
| Interior access | Pets, children, allergies, and tenant access can change preparation and timing. | What prep steps, product category, and re-entry window apply? |
| Pest category | General insects, termites, bed bugs, mosquitoes, and wildlife are usually scoped and priced separately. | Which pests are covered by this visit and which need a separate quote? |

How to Prevent Pests in Your Toppenish Home
Reduce pest problems in your Toppenish home with these prevention strategies:
- Seal entry points – Inspect foundations and weather stripping, especially important given Washington's moisture-related pests due to high rainfall.
- Reduce moisture – Fix leaks promptly; carpenter ants and other pests are attracted to water sources.
- Store food properly – Use sealed containers to avoid attracting moisture ants and rodents.
- Maintain your yard – Trim vegetation away from your home to reduce pest harborage areas.

What's the difference between an exterminator and pest control in Toppenish?
In Toppenish, the terms are often used interchangeably. Technically, exterminators focus on eliminating existing pests, while pest control includes prevention. Most Washington companies offer both services.

Is pest control tax deductible in Toppenish?
For Toppenish homeowners, pest control is generally not tax deductible for personal residences. However, if you have a home office or rental property in Washington, it may qualify as a business expense. Consult a tax professional.
